Technology Overview
Luminus Big Chip LEDs™ benefit from a suite of innovations in the fields of chip technology, packaging and thermal management. These
breakthroughs allow illumination engineers and designers to achieve solutions that are high brightness and high efficiency.
Photonic Lattice Technology
Luminus’ photonic lattice technology enables large area LED
chips with uniform brightness over the entire LED chip surface.
The optical power and brightness produced by these large
monolithic chips enable solutions which replace arc and
halogen lamps where arrays of traditional high power LEDs
cannot.
For red, green and blue LEDs, the photonic lattice structures
extract more light and create radiation patterns that are more
collimated than traditional LEDs. Having higher collimation
from the source increases optical collection effi ciencies and
simplifies optical designs.
Reliability
Designed from the ground up, Luminus Big Chip LEDs are one of
the most reliable light sources in the world today. Big Chip LEDs
have passed a rigorous suite of environmental and mechanical
stress tests, including mechanical shock, vibration, temperature
cycling and humidity, and have been fully qualifi ed for use in
extreme high power and high current applications. With very
low failure rates and median lifetimes that typically exceed
60,000 hours, Luminus Big Chip LEDs are ready for even the
most demanding applications.
Packaging Technology
Thermal management is critical in high power LED applications.
With a thermal resistance from junction to heat sink of 1.8º C/W,
Luminus CBT-40 LEDs have the lowest thermal resistance of any
LED on the market. This allows the LED to be driven at higher
current densities while maintaining a low junction temperature,
thereby resulting in brighter solutions and longer lifetimes.
Environmental Benefits
Luminus LEDs help reduce power consumption and the amount
of hazardous waste entering the environment. All Big Chip LED
products manufactured by Luminus are RoHS compliant and
free of hazardous materials, including lead and mercury.
Understanding Big Chip LED Test Specifications
Every Luminus LED is fully tested to ensure that it meets the high quality standards expected from Luminus’ products.
Testing Temperature
Luminus core board products are typically measured in such a
way that the characteristics reported agree with how the
devices will actually perform when incorporated into a system.
This measurement is accomplished by mounting the devices on
a 40ºC heat sink and allowing the device to reach thermal
equilibrium while fully powered. Only after the device reaches
equilibrium are the measurements taken. This method of
measurement ensures that Luminus Big Chip LEDs perform in
the field just as they are specifi ed.
Multiple Operating Points (1.4 A, 5.9 A, 9.8 A)
The tables on the following pages provide typical optical and
electrical characteristics. Since the LEDs can be operated over a
wide range of drive conditions (currents from <1 A to 10 A, and
duty cycle from <1% to 100%) multiple drive conditions are
listed. CBT-40 devices are specified at 5.9 A. The values shown at
1.4 A and 9.8 A are for additional reference at other possible
drive conditions.
